Don’t Over Clean Carpets

Carpet cleaning

If you have carpet floors, they must be cleaned regularly by vacuuming as often as possible. Especially if your home has high humidity, as mould can grow easily in humid homes. Vacuuming frequently also helps to get rid of dust mites, which can help reduce irritation for those who suffer from asthma and other allergies. 

With that being said, washing your carpets and rugs too much can damage the carpet fibres, particularly if you use a harsh cleaner. Overwashing carpets can also result in residue being left behind or wicking of the carpet, which can give it an unwashed look, even if it has been cleaned.

Do Follow Cleaning Product Instructions

When cleaning your floors, avoid damaging or scratching the floors by using the right sort of equipment and solutions for cleaning. For more tips, read how to clean and mop all types of flooring in your home. Here are 5 tips to help you out:

  1. Always read the manufacturer’s instructions for cleaning before you start.
  2. Be aware that there are some cleaning products that leave a residue. 
  3. When cleaning laminate flooring or hardwood floors, make sure to not use too much water.
  4. Be sure to use a soft, damp mop or brush appropriate for cleaning floors.
  5. Choose cleaning products that are made specifically for your floors, rather than all-purpose cleaners. 

Don’t Forget The Baseboards And Ceiling Fans

When dusting, we often dust shelves, TV stands, lamps, and other reachable areas. But, ceiling fans and baseboards are generally neglected. 

To clean ceiling fans, use a feather duster or even a pillow case covering a broom to clean the dust on the fan blades. The baseboards can be cleaned simply by vacuuming with a brush attachment, a sponge, or a duster. Clean the baseboards after cleaning your floors to ensure that dust from the baseboards doesn’t end up on the clean floor.

Don’t Let Grease Build Up

In your kitchen, the grease must be cleaned from the walls, backsplash, the inside of your oven, and your stovetop. Grease is not only gross and unsightly, but also poses a risk of potential fire hazards.

Do Clean The Kitchen Sink

If you don’t clean the kitchen sink, you’ll have bad smells and an unhygienic washing area in your kitchen. Keep germs away by removing blockages from the drain. If you’re able to identify what’s causing the block, use baking soda, vinegar, water, lemon peels, etc. to freshen and clean. 

Use a sponge and scrub away watermarks and stains from the sink, and don’t forget to wipe the taps too. 

Don’t Leave Out Larger Appliances 

Don’t skip over bigger items in the kitchen like the dishwasher and washing machine, although they do clean frequently. Dishwashers accumulate build-up that can make the dishwasher-less effective. Try to remember to remove pieces of food after every wash. And, clean the gasket with a damp cloth, as well as the rubber seal. Be sure to clean the filter and wipe down the door of the dishwasher, the handles, and the controls. Clean the drain trap to ensure that no food bits or objects get stuck in it.

Just as a dishwasher is always cleaning dishes, your washing machine constantly cleans clothes, but still needs to be cleaned itself. There is build-up that can occur in the washing machine, resulting in a bad odour. To keep your washing machine in working condition, clean the washing machine drum, gasket, and door.

Do Follow The Grain On Stainless Steel Appliances

Similar to wood, stainless steel has a grain. You should always wipe in the direction of the grain to avoid dirt or cleaning products from getting into the cracks. It’s best to also use a microfiber cloth and cleaning products that are made specifically for stainless steel to prevent damage to your appliances.

Don’t Leave Spills On Tile Grout

Tile is great at being resistant to water and spills, but the grout is different. The grout is porous, meaning it can easily become discoloured or stained. Keep the grout clean by wiping it regularly, wiping up spills immediately, and sealing the grout now and then.

Do Clean High-Touch Surfaces

It’s important to wipe down your high-touch surfaces every day to get rid of germs. These areas are your light switches, door handles, keyboards, mouse, and doorknobs. Use disinfectant wipes to eliminate the spread of illnesses.
